🇧🇹 Ambient Cafe, Thimphu: A Taste of Conscious Living in the Happiest Kingdom
More Than Coffee: How a Thimphu Gem Reflects Bhutan’s Green Heart
In a country where Gross National Happiness (GNH) is the guiding philosophy, every business is encouraged to prioritize sustainability and community. The Ambient Cafe in Thimphu isn't just a beloved spot for tourists and locals; it’s an early example of how a casual urban cafe can embody Bhutan's "Clean, Green" spirit.
Since opening its doors, this cozy haven has become the perfect reflection of the kingdom’s commitment to environmental preservation and a wholesome way of life.
🌱 Vegetarian Focus: Supporting a Wholesome Diet
While the Ambient Cafe offers a Western-style menu of coffees, paninis, and cakes, its culinary focus aligns perfectly with Bhutan’s vegetarian-friendly culture:
-
Vegetarian First: The menu is primarily vegetarian, offering simple, fresh options like grilled sandwiches, paninis, and fresh salads, which naturally require fewer resources to produce than meat-heavy menus.
-
Vegan Options Available: Recognizing the growing demand for plant-based food, the cafe is known for offering labeled vegan items, including cakes (like the beloved banana cake) and savory options like the popular eggplant hummus cutlet burger. You can also often find soy milk for your coffee—a great find in the Himalayas!
-
Fresh and Simple Ingredients: The cafe's commitment to using fresh, local ingredients not only ensures a delicious taste but also minimizes the long-distance carbon footprint associated with imported produce, directly supporting Bhutanese farmers.
♻️ Eco-Friendly Vibe: Sustainability in Practice
Ambient Cafe’s operations quietly contribute to Bhutan’s goal of maintaining its carbon-negative status:
-
Plastic Reduction: The cafe is highlighted for using less plastic and actively promoting "clean, green habits," aligning with Bhutan's broader national efforts to minimize single-use plastics and waste.
-
Community Hub & Book Exchange: By offering a space with free Wi-Fi and hosting a "take one, leave one" book exchange, the cafe promotes the sharing economy and encourages community interaction, reducing the need for constant consumption of new media and fostering a deeper sense of belonging.
-
Central, Walkable Location: Located on Norzin Lam near the Clock Tower Square, the cafe is situated in the heart of the capital, making it easily accessible on foot or via Thimphu's burgeoning Electric Vehicle (EV) taxi network, promoting low-carbon travel for visitors.
